This surely won't be possible because palettes have specific colours and would surely come out really bad. He could be able to get these sprites correctly (with appropirate colours), but all the other characters using the same palette in the game would have their colours messed up.

There's the matter of size, too. You can't just randomly stuff sprites of any size and shape into a ROM and expect to get away with it.
